Virtual Reality (VR) is transforming the landscape of healthcare training and care delivery by providing immersive, interactive experiences that enhance learning and patient engagement. Unlike traditional methods, VR allows healthcare professionals to practice in lifelike scenarios without the associated risks. This innovative approach fosters better retention of knowledge and skills, as practitioners can repeatedly engage with complex procedures and emergency situations in a safe environment. By simulating real-life clinical settings, VR prepares trainees to respond more effectively when faced with actual patient care.
Moreover, VR's application extends beyond training; it revolutionizes patient care delivery. For example, VR can help alleviate anxiety for patients undergoing medical procedures, providing a distraction that enhances their overall experience. Furthermore, it facilitates telehealth by creating virtual environments where patients can receive consultations from specialists regardless of their location. This accessibility not only improves patient outcomes but also addresses gaps in healthcare provision, particularly in underserved areas. As we continue to integrate VR into healthcare, its potential to transform both training and patient care will only become more significant.
When it comes to picking out the right VR training solutions in healthcare, you’ve really got to focus on interactivity and realism. Honestly, the more immersive the training feels, the better folks will remember what they learn and the skills they need. So, it’s a good idea to look for platforms that boast high-quality graphics and simulations that closely mimic the real-life scenarios healthcare professionals are bound to face. This kind of realism not only keeps trainees engaged but also helps them get ready for those intense situations they might encounter in their careers.
Another super important thing to think about is how adaptable the VR solution is. Different healthcare specialties each have their own training needs, right? So, having a flexible curriculum is key. Make sure to choose a program that can be tailored to various medical fields, whether that’s for surgical training, patient care, or emergency response. Oh, and don’t forget to check if the VR training program comes with solid analytics and feedback tools to keep track of progress and pinpoint areas that might need a bit of work. By focusing on these elements, healthcare organizations can really make sure they’re selecting VR training solutions that genuinely boost education and readiness among their teams.

You know, dealing with regulatory compliance for virtual reality (VR) in healthcare training is super important when you're rolling out new programs. Healthcare professionals really have to navigate a maze of strict rules—think HIPAA and FDA guidelines—when it comes to using cutting-edge tech in clinical environments. So, when you’re bringing VR into training, it's crucial to make sure every piece of content checks all the boxes on these regulations; that way, we protect patient confidentiality and keep everyone safe. Developers really need to team up with legal and compliance folks to get a solid look at the VR content, making sure nothing slips through the cracks that could expose sensitive patient info or break any rules.
And let’s not forget, as technology keeps evolving, we’ve got to stay on our toes with the regulations. As VR training tools get fancier, regulatory bodies might shake things up and update their rules to keep pace with all the cool innovations. So, organizations have to be proactive—regularly reviewing their training programs against new regulations and best practices. This isn’t just about avoiding legal headaches; it’s also about building trust with staff, patients, and everyone involved. In the end, this trust can really help boost the effectiveness of VR as a killer training tool in healthcare.
